>> PMC approval is not required for IP Logs.
>>
>> It's a little early to submit them. The IP policy states that the Release
>> Review is the trigger for IP review, and--while it doesn't indicate a
>> specific lead time--my interpretation is that the IP review take place
>> weeks in advance of the release review, not months.
>>
>> Are any development activities planned for these projects between now and
>> the release date?
>>
>> FWIW the participation requirements are that the Release record be
>> created, not that you engage immediately in the review.
